OPSCC-2025-02 NSW Public Service Senior Executive Remuneration Management Framework

Description

The NSW Public Service Senior Executive Remuneration Management Framework (the Framework) has been updated to reflect the 2025 Statutory and Other Offices Remuneration Tribunal (SOORT) determination. 

Detailed Outline

Public Service Senior Executives (PSSEs) are employed in 1 of 4 bands specified in the Government Sector Employment (Senior Executive Bands) Determination 2014. In accordance with section 40(1) of the Government Sector Employment Act 2013 (GSE Act), the remuneration package of a PSSE must be within the range determined under the Statutory and Other Offices Remuneration Act 1975 (SOOR Act) for the band in which the executive is employed.

2025-26 NSW Public Service Senior Executive Remuneration Management Framework

The Framework applies to PSSE bands 1, 2 and 3. The discretionary ranges and the formulas for each job evaluation methodology have been adjusted to reflect the 3.5 percent increase determined by SOORT.
